I have an existing 3-dimensional mock-up of a product box and I need it flattened into a clean, print-ready vector die-line that I can open and edit in Adobe Illustrator. Accuracy is critical—the finished file has to line up perfectly with the dimensions and folds shown in the mock-up so our packaging prints without surprises.
Here’s what I expect in the final hand-off:
• One Adobe Illustrator (.ai) file with separate layers for cut lines, fold/score lines, safety, and bleed
• CMYK setup with a 3 mm bleed added.
• A PDF proof exported from the .ai file so I can double-check before sending to be printed
